Subject: Re: [PATCH] mtd: improve calculating partition boundaries when checking for alignment

> From: Rafał Miłecki <rafal@milecki.pl>
> 
> When checking for alignment mtd should check absolute offsets. It's
> important for subpartitions as it doesn't make sense to check their
> relative addresses.
> 
> Signed-off-by: Rafał Miłecki <rafal@milecki.pl>
> ---
>  drivers/mtd/mtdpart.c | 13 +++++++++++--
>  1 file changed, 11 insertions(+), 2 deletions(-)
> 
> diff --git a/drivers/mtd/mtdpart.c b/drivers/mtd/mtdpart.c
> index 2b6e53af47da..15197d923ec0 100644
> --- a/drivers/mtd/mtdpart.c
> +++ b/drivers/mtd/mtdpart.c
> @@ -61,6 +61,15 @@ static inline struct mtd_part *mtd_to_part(const struct mtd_info *mtd)
>  	return container_of(mtd, struct mtd_part, mtd);
>  }
>  
> +static uint64_t part_absolute_offset(struct mtd_info *mtd)

	  ^ u64

Looks good otherwise.

> +{
> +	struct mtd_part *part = mtd_to_part(mtd);
> +
> +	if (!mtd_is_partition(mtd))
> +		return 0;
> +
> +	return part_absolute_offset(part->parent) + part->offset;
> +}
>  
>  /*
>   * MTD methods which simply translate the effective address and pass through
> @@ -514,7 +523,7 @@ static struct mtd_part *allocate_partition(struct mtd_info *parent,
>  	if (!(slave->mtd.flags & MTD_NO_ERASE))
>  		wr_alignment = slave->mtd.erasesize;
>  
> -	tmp = slave->offset;
> +	tmp = part_absolute_offset(parent) + slave->offset;
>  	remainder = do_div(tmp, wr_alignment);
>  	if ((slave->mtd.flags & MTD_WRITEABLE) && remainder) {
>  		/* Doesn't start on a boundary of major erase size */
> @@ -525,7 +534,7 @@ static struct mtd_part *allocate_partition(struct mtd_info *parent,
>  			part->name);
>  	}
>  
> -	tmp = slave->mtd.size;
> +	tmp = part_absolute_offset(parent) + slave->mtd.size;
>  	remainder = do_div(tmp, wr_alignment);
>  	if ((slave->mtd.flags & MTD_WRITEABLE) && remainder) {
>  		slave->mtd.flags &= ~MTD_WRITEABLE;
